Cranes Software International Ltd., a scientific and engineering software solutions provider, today reported a net profit after tax of Rs 136.6 million for the second quarter ended September 30, 2005, up 66% from Rs. 82.3 million reported for the corresponding quarter last year.
The operating revenues of the company increased 31% to Rs 477.1 million compared to Rs 363.9 million reported during the year-ago period. The earnings per share was up at Rs 13.4 compared to Rs 8.09.
For the half-year ended September 30, the net profit after tax was up by 48% to Rs 266.2 million from Rs 179.3 million reported for the corresponding half last year. The operating revenues for this period was pegged at Rs 948.6 million, up 31% from Rs 724.1 million during the corresponding period the previous year.
During the latest half the EPS was up at Rs 26.19 compared to Rs 17.64.
